Wednesday, June 17, 2026
No Result
View All Result
Crypeto News
  • Home
  • Bitcoin
  • Crypto Updates
    • General
    • Blockchain
    • Ethereum
    • Altcoin
    • Mining
    • Crypto Exchanges
  • NFT
  • DeFi
  • Web3
  • Metaverse
  • Analysis
  • Regulations
  • Scam Alert
  • Videos
CRYPTO MARKETCAP
  • Home
  • Bitcoin
  • Crypto Updates
    • General
    • Blockchain
    • Ethereum
    • Altcoin
    • Mining
    • Crypto Exchanges
  • NFT
  • DeFi
  • Web3
  • Metaverse
  • Analysis
  • Regulations
  • Scam Alert
  • Videos
CRYPTO MARKETCAP
Crypeto News
No Result
View All Result

BitStream: A Protocol For Atomic Data Exchange

by crypetonews
November 15, 2023
in Bitcoin
Reading Time: 3 mins read
0 0
A A
0
Home Bitcoin
Share on FacebookShare on Twitter


Atomically purchasing digital files with digital currency is an idea that has a long history in this space. Digital goods, digital money, the two seem like a perfect pairing together. Digital goods, i.e. information, are also massive markets. Think about all the video, audio, text, games, and other forms of digital content that people purchase and consume on a regular basis. These are markets worth billions and billions of dollars that people interact with on a daily basis.

Most of the serious attempts at implementing paid file sharing have gone down bad roads. Filecoin was an attempt to do this on top of IPFS, but ultimately the project is absurdly over engineered. BitTorrent (the company, not the protocol) was bought by Justin Sun and integrated its own cryptocurrency and blockchain. Both of these projects have effectively gone nowhere productive, with extremely overengineered systems on the technical side, and very dubious incentives on the economic side.

BitStream is a proposal by Robin Linus (ever consider slowing down and taking a break Robin?) to attempt to address the requirements of atomicly purchasing data without the pointless addition of altcoins and over engineered technical protocols for the exchange.

All files can be uniquely identified by a single hash, this is a very important detail in this scheme. Selling a file atomically requires encrypting the file using a function that allows the user to verify what is encrypted, and after having done so the user atomically purchases the encryption key for the file. The problem is the verification process, and more importantly proving if you were cheated and the file decrypts to incorrect data, is expensive. Naively done, you would need to produce the entire encrypted file and the decryption key so others could decrypt it and verify the decrypted data did not match the expected hash value when hashed.

File-sharing systems like BitTorrent frequently break files up into standard sized chunks and build a merkle tree out of them, which allows the root hash to function as a file identifier in a magnet link and to verify each individual chunk of a file you download is a valid piece of that file. This is a property that can be taken advantage of to drastically improve the efficiency of fraud proofs showing a file distributor cheated you.

The seller of the file can generate a random value and use this to encrypt each file chunk using a XOR operation against that random value. They can then sign an attestation of the encrypted file root hash and the hash of the encryption value. The encrypted file tree is set up in a special way to facilitate simple fraud proofs.

Instead of building the merkle tree out of just the normal file chunks, but encrypted, the tree creates pairs of leaves that consist of one encrypted file chunk and the hash of the unencrypted file chunk next to it. Now at this point the buyer can download the encrypted file, and after verifying by taking all of the hashes of the unencrypted chunks and creating a merkle tree from them to ensure they match the root hash of the unencrypted file, can atomically purchase the decryption value. This is accomplished by the seller using it as the preimage to an HTLC over the Lightning network or a chaumian ecash mint like Cashu which supports HTLCs.

If the file does not decrypt correctly, either because the encrypted data is a different file or the preimage is not the actual encryption key, the merkle path in the encrypted file tree to any two leaves can show the seller cheated the buyer. Providing just the path to any encrypted file chunk and its corresponding unencrypted chunk hash with the preimage the buyer purchased will prove definitively the seller did not provide the buyer with the file they claimed they were.

Any file seller using the BitStream protocol can deposit a bond that can be slashed with a fraud proof as designed above if they cheat a customer. This can be enforced by simply depositing a bond at a chaumian mint in the simplest case. Platforms like Liquid offer alternative methods of building a bond that can actually be enforced trustlessly with functionality like OP_CAT. Scripts could be constructed that actually take the BitStream fraud proof and validate it on the stack, allowing the creation of a UTXO that would be spendable by anyone who had a valid fraud proof. If OP_CAT ever became available on the mainchain, this could even be done completely trustlessly without needing a federated execution environment. 

BitStream is an incredibly promising protocol for atomically selling digital information with a very efficient scheme for proving fraud, no shitcoins required. 



Source link

Tags: AtomicBitStreamDataExchangeProtocol
Previous Post

LIVE: Disney Launches NEW NFT Series – What about Ecomi / Veve?

Next Post

New Era Of Licensing And Taxation Unfolds

Related Posts

AI Expert: Truth Protocols Could Become the SSL of the Information Age
Bitcoin

AI Expert: Truth Protocols Could Become the SSL of the Information Age

August 24, 2025
Analyst Says Dogecoin Price Is Entering Expansion Phase, Here’s What It Means
Bitcoin

Analyst Says Dogecoin Price Is Entering Expansion Phase, Here’s What It Means

August 24, 2025
Ethereum’s Tech Edge Could Outshine Bitcoin — Here’s How
Bitcoin

Ethereum’s Tech Edge Could Outshine Bitcoin — Here’s How

August 23, 2025
XRP Open Interest On CME Futures Has Hit A New ATH, Why Price Could Surge
Bitcoin

XRP Open Interest On CME Futures Has Hit A New ATH, Why Price Could Surge

August 23, 2025
Ethereum Price Watch: ,700 Holds Strong—Is K Within Reach?
Bitcoin

Ethereum Price Watch: $4,700 Holds Strong—Is $5K Within Reach?

August 23, 2025
Ethereum Hits New ATH of ,880, $BEST to Rally Next
Bitcoin

Ethereum Hits New ATH of $4,880, $BEST to Rally Next

August 23, 2025
Next Post
New Era Of Licensing And Taxation Unfolds

New Era Of Licensing And Taxation Unfolds

6 Best Cheap Crypto to Buy Now Under 1 Dollar November 15

6 Best Cheap Crypto to Buy Now Under 1 Dollar November 15

Leave a Reply Cancel reply

Your email address will not be published. Required fields are marked *

RECOMMENDED

No Content Available

  • USD
  • EUR
  • GBP
  • AUD
  • JPY
  • bitcoinBitcoin(BTC)
    $65,890.000.27%
  • ethereumEthereum(ETH)
    $1,777.15-0.29%
  • tetherTether(USDT)
    $1.00-0.01%
  • binancecoinBNB(BNB)
    $606.610.34%
  • rippleXRP(XRP)
    $1.21-0.08%
  • usd-coinUSDC(USDC)
    $1.00-0.01%
  • solanaSolana(SOL)
    $73.760.67%
  • tronTRON(TRX)
    $0.3213571.24%
  • Figure HelocFigure Heloc(FIGR_HELOC)
    $1.02-1.08%
  • HyperliquidHyperliquid(HYPE)
    $75.162.15%
  • Trending
  • Comments
  • Latest
4 Expert Tips to Turn Blank Pages Into Business Blueprints

4 Expert Tips to Turn Blank Pages Into Business Blueprints

October 21, 2024
Top Crypto Portfolio Rebalancing Tools (Automated & Manual)

Top Crypto Portfolio Rebalancing Tools (Automated & Manual)

April 13, 2025
What are Meta Transactions? Exploring ERC-2771

What are Meta Transactions? Exploring ERC-2771

October 25, 2023
How to Set Up NFT Sales Notifications

How to Set Up NFT Sales Notifications

October 19, 2023
Uniswap v4 Teases Major Updates for 2025

Uniswap v4 Teases Major Updates for 2025

January 2, 2025
A 98% Crash and a Pump & Dump

A 98% Crash and a Pump & Dump

August 8, 2025
AI Expert: Truth Protocols Could Become the SSL of the Information Age

AI Expert: Truth Protocols Could Become the SSL of the Information Age

August 24, 2025
Analyst Says Dogecoin Price Is Entering Expansion Phase, Here’s What It Means

Analyst Says Dogecoin Price Is Entering Expansion Phase, Here’s What It Means

August 24, 2025
Robert Kiyosaki Exposes Brutal Truth Behind Sudden Wealth and Collapse

Robert Kiyosaki Exposes Brutal Truth Behind Sudden Wealth and Collapse

August 24, 2025
Ethereum’s Tech Edge Could Outshine Bitcoin — Here’s How

Ethereum’s Tech Edge Could Outshine Bitcoin — Here’s How

August 23, 2025
IRS Loses Top Crypto Enforcer After Only 90 Days on the Job

IRS Loses Top Crypto Enforcer After Only 90 Days on the Job

August 23, 2025
US Court Grants Stay In Coinbase Biometric Data Lawsuit — Details

US Court Grants Stay In Coinbase Biometric Data Lawsuit — Details

August 23, 2025
Crypeto News

Find the latest Bitcoin, Ethereum, blockchain, crypto, Business, Fintech News, interviews, and price analysis at Crypeto News.

CATEGORIES

  • Altcoin
  • Analysis
  • Bitcoin
  • Blockchain
  • Crypto Exchanges
  • Crypto Updates
  • DeFi
  • Ethereum
  • Metaverse
  • Mining
  • NFT
  • Regulations
  • Scam Alert
  • Uncategorized
  • Videos
  • Web3

LATEST UPDATES

  • AI Expert: Truth Protocols Could Become the SSL of the Information Age
  • Analyst Says Dogecoin Price Is Entering Expansion Phase, Here’s What It Means
  • Robert Kiyosaki Exposes Brutal Truth Behind Sudden Wealth and Collapse
  • Disclaimer
  • Privacy Policy
  • DMCA
  • Cookie Privacy Policy
  • Terms and Conditions
  • Contact us
  • About Us

Copyright © 2022 Crypeto News.
Crypeto News is not responsible for the content of external sites.

No Result
View All Result
  • Home
  • Bitcoin
  • Crypto Updates
    • General
    • Blockchain
    • Ethereum
    • Altcoin
    • Mining
    • Crypto Exchanges
  • NFT
  • DeFi
  • Web3
  • Metaverse
  • Analysis
  • Regulations
  • Scam Alert
  • Videos

Copyright © 2022 Crypeto News.
Crypeto News is not responsible for the content of external sites.

Welcome Back!

Login to your account below

Forgotten Password?

Retrieve your password

Please enter your username or email address to reset your password.

Log In